The closure of this XXIII Edition is entrusted to the Swiss violinist Esther Hoppe.
Acclaimed by the press for her beautiful sound, her exceptional stylistic mastery and her virtuosic yet sensitive interpretations, in which her astonishing technique is at the service of the purest music-making.
With her violin of 1722, the "De Ahna" by Antonio Stradivari, she will let us listen to 3 works (2 Partitas and 1 Sonata) from the admirable opus for solo violin by Johann Sebastian Bach, whose autograph dates back to 1720.
The art of performing Bach's Sonatas and Partitas is not only based on violinistic qualities that can be traced back to perfect intonation and technique.
Bach has in fact attempted in this masterful opus a sort of "violinistic squaring of the circle", managing to create a linear polyphony on an instrument that is monodic by nature.
This magnificent program, entrusted to the expertise of our artist, will resound in the place that perhaps best suits Bach's music, once again the Basilica on the island of San Giulio.
